HEM - Brake Shop (JO 7-26)

Oahu Transit Services, Inc
Honolulu, HI Full Time
POSTED ON 3/19/2026
AVAILABLE BEFORE 5/3/2026
Essential Functions for the Position:
Individual to perform inspections and maintenance, diagnosis and repair, overhauling and servicing of transit vehicle brake related systems.

Special Knowledge & Skills:
1. Must be familiar with all phases of troubleshooting, using current diagnostic equipment and methods; and must be able to troubleshoot and diagnose engine, transmission, driveline, electrical, electronic, hydraulic, brake and air systems found on transit vehicles.
2. Must be able to read and understand technical publications, material safety data sheets, operational schematics (to include electrical, hydraulic and pneumatic systems) and efficiently apply principles of mechanics to transit vehicle repairs.
3. Must be familiar with current safety equipment and procedures.
4. Must be able to preplan daily work schedules and assume acting supervisory position as required.
5. Must have demonstrated effective written/oral communication skills.

Education, Training & Experience:
1. Must be high school or trade school graduate.
2. A minimum of six (6) years' practical working experience in the heavy duty vehicle field is preferred, including at least four (4) years' experience with diesel engines and/or associated power train technology.

Other Job Requirement & Conditions:
1. Must meet or be able to meet all present and future license and certification requirements as may be required by City, State, or Federal governments.
2. Must have valid Hawaii State driver's license with clean traffic abstract, and must be able to pass State of Hawaii D.O.T. driving requirements for a "Type B" commercial driver's license.
3. Must pass Company administered written and oral examinations.
4. Must be able to meet standard physical requirements and pass Company sponsored medical examination and drug screening.
5. Must be highly motivated individual with excellent work performance and attendance records; and must be willing and able to work various shifts, overtime as directed, holiday duty as required, and assume days off as assigned.
6. Must be willing and able to work in the Brake Inspection section as assigned.
